public PagedResultOutput <PaymentMethodFullDto> GetAll(GetListPaymentMethodInputDto inputDto) { var result = _paymentMethodRepository.GetAll().OrderBy(i => i.Bank.Name).PageBy(inputDto).ToList(); var count = _paymentMethodRepository.GetAll().Count(); return(new PagedResultOutput <PaymentMethodFullDto>(count, Mapper.Map <List <PaymentMethodFullDto> >(result))); }
public PagedResultOutput <PaymentMethodFullDto> GetFullByPagging([FromQuery] GetListPaymentMethodInputDto inputDto) { var paymentMethods = _paymentMethodAppService.GetAll(inputDto); return(paymentMethods); }